Holding tanks are used to temporarily store wastewater and solid sewage waste. They are common in businesses in Calgary and in acreages, barns and shops. Once a holding tank is filled, you must get it emptied by a vacuum truck to haul the waste to a proper waste disposal site. Holding tanks do not have a leaching drain field like septic tanks to dispose of wastewater.

What Is a Holding Tank?
Unlike a septic tank, a holding tank has no drain field — it simply stores all wastewater until it’s pumped out. This makes regular emptying essential. Holding tanks are common on acreages, farms, barns, shops, and properties where a full septic system isn’t practical or permitted.
How Often Does a Holding Tank Need to Be Pumped?
Most residential holding tanks need to be emptied roughly once a month, though this varies depending on tank size and household usage. In summer months, higher water usage often means more frequent service. Your tank’s high-level alarm will alert you when it’s getting full — don’t ignore it. Letting a holding tank overflow creates a health hazard and can result in fines under Alberta environmental regulations.
